7-Day Thailand Trip for 4k per Person

7-day Thailand trip, enjoy exotic customs! From bustling Bangkok to tranquil islands, this detailed guide will help you explore Thailand with ease. Don't miss out! . Thailand, with its long history and picturesque scenery🌴, is home to magnificent temples🏯, white sandy beaches, and clear waters🏖️. The unique local customs and friendly people will make you want to stay forever! . 🛣️Route suggestions: DAY1: Shanghai✈️Phuket Arrive in Phuket and start your vacation! Feel the charm of the Pearl of the Andaman Sea🏖️. DAY2: Phang Nga Bay National Park -> James Bond Island -> Phang Nga Bay Kayaking -> Chillva Market Explore the wonders of Phang Nga Bay, visit James Bond Island, enjoy kayaking, and visit Chillva Market for delicious food🍜. DAY3: Phi Phi Don -> Phi Phi Leh -> Tonsai Bay -> Koh Khai Explore the Phi Phi Islands, enjoy the beautiful scenery of Tonsai Bay, and visit the unique landscape of Koh Khai🐣. DAY4: Naka Island -> Phuket Town Head to Naka Island for a relaxing time, then visit Phuket Town to experience the local culture🏘️. DAY5: Phuket Town Weekend Market Visit the Phuket Town Weekend Market for local handicrafts and food🛍️. DAY6: Phuket✈Shanghai End your wonderful trip to Phuket and return to Shanghai🛫. DAY7: Arrive safely in Shanghai🏡 Reluctantly end your trip, arrive safely in Shanghai, and look forward to the next time💕. . Must-see attractions: 🌟 Phuket Town 🌟🌟 Recommendation: ⭐⭐⭐⭐ Address: Old Phuket Town, Mueang Phuket District, Phuket 83000, Thailand Opening hours: All day Duration: 2-4 hours A cultural treasure trove of Phuket, stroll through the quaint streets and experience the exotic atmosphere. 🏝️ Phi Phi Don 🌴 Recommendation: ⭐⭐⭐⭐ Address: Ao Nang, Mueang Krabi District, Krabi, Thailand Opening hours: All day Duration: 1-3 days Emerald waters and natural scenery complement each other, enjoy the pure island time. 🐸 Chillva Market 🍢 Recommendation: ⭐⭐⭐⭐ Address: Phuket, Thailand Opening hours: Mon-Sat 17:00-23:00 Duration: 1-3 hours A clean Thai night market in Phuket, Thailand, with a wide variety of food and a beautiful environment, is a great place to taste authentic Thai snacks. . Tips: 📌Thailand is visa-free, so bring your passport and enjoy your trip! 🛍️For specialties such as Thai silk and handicrafts, compare prices before buying. 🍜Try authentic food, such as curry shrimp and mango sticky rice. 🌞Be sure to protect yourself from the sun, and don't forget your hat and sunglasses. 💸Prepare some cash, as tipping is common here. 🚖You can choose Grab or a taxi for travel, which is convenient and fast. . Phuket is known for its dreamy beaches, snorkeling, and resorts, but if you've ever visited Phuket Town, you'll be pleasantly surprised by its vibrant streets, hipster vibe, and diverse shops! This time, I chose to stay in Phuket Town to experience the island's vibrant life: not only are there colorful Baroque and Portuguese-style buildings, but there are also unique cafes and street vendors. Strolling, stopping, snapping photos, and eating is a completely different kind of laid-back beach experience. Phuket Town Travel Guide: Recommended Attractions 1. Thalang Road Phuket Town's iconic photo-op street, where each house is painted a different color, hosts a night market on Saturday and Sunday evenings (Phuket Walking Street), featuring local snacks and handmade goods. It's the perfect spot for strolling, eating, and taking photos! 📍Address: Thalang Rd, Tambon Talat Yai, Amphoe Mueang Phuket, Chang Wat Phuket 🕒 Opening Hours: Night Market Saturday and Sunday evenings, approximately 4:00 PM - 10:00 PM 2. Soi Romanee This highly popular alleyway boasts stunning colors and is lined with a variety of cafes and ice cream shops. Visit around 3:00 PM or 4:00 PM, as the slanting sunlight creates stunning photo opportunities in every corner! Some shops are only open until the evening, so be sure to time your visit accordingly. 📍Address: Soi Romanee, Tambon Talat Yai, Amphoe Mueang Phuket, Chang Wat Phuket 🕒 Opening Hours: Most cafes are open from 11:00 AM to 7:00 PM 3. Limelight Avenue Phuket If you're tired of shopping, the small shopping mall, Limelight Avenue Phuket, is a great place to relax. It's air-conditioned and offers a wide selection of local specialties, restaurants, and even some cultural and creative gift shops. 📍Address: 2/23 Dibuk Rd, Tambon Talat Yai, Amphoe Mueang Phuket, Chang Wat Phuket 🕒 Opening Hours: 10:00 AM - 9:00 PM 4. Phuket Town Old Street Art Gallery The entire old town is filled with colorful houses and street graffiti murals. Strolling through the alleys, you'll occasionally encounter street artists performing and painting graffiti, making it a great place to explore and collect "urban Easter eggs." Tips + Further Reflections Compared to the bustling beaches, Phuket Town has a much slower pace. You can spend an entire afternoon just sitting in any small shop. The cool mornings are perfect for taking photos. In the evenings and during the night market, the twinkling lights create a truly atmospheric atmosphere. Most shops here accept cash, so it's recommended to have Thai baht ready. Some popular restaurants have queues, so arrive early to secure a table! Transportation & Nearby Useful Information - Phuket Airport: Take the airport shuttle bus directly to Phuket Town, which takes about an hour and ends at Phuket Bus Terminal 1. - Getting around town: Most areas are easily accessible on foot, or by Tuk Tuk or motorcycle taxi, making short trips very convenient. - Food Recommendations: The night market recommends grilled bananas and Thai milk tea, and the handmade coconut ice cream at Soi Romanee is a must-try! (Approximately 80 THB per scoop, refreshing and smooth.) Just spent a dreamy few days bouncing between Takua Thung and Phuket 🏝️🌅 — think crystal-clear water, epic views, and jaw-dropping temples! If you love swimming and island-hopping, this itinerary absolutely delivers. Top Spots to Visit: 1. Ko Tapu (James Bond Island), Krasom Subdistrict, Takua Thung — Famous for its movie cameo! Open 8:00–17:00 daily, get there early for less crowds and those crazy scenic selfies. 2. Khao Phing Kan, Phang Nga — Explore caves and beaches, open 9:00–21:00. Perfect for swimming and admiring those limestone cliffs. 3. Chaithararam Temple – Wat Chalong, Chao Fah Tawan Tok Rd, Phuket — Cultural must-see, open 8:00–17:00 year-round. Respect dress code, keep shoulders and knees covered. 4. The Big Buddha, Phuket — Hike up for panoramic island views and calm vibes. 5. 333 At The Beach, Kamala — Delicious Thai food right on the sand! Try the Pad Thai and mango sticky rice, 333/3 Moo 3, Kamala, Kathu. 6. Twinpalms MontAzure Phuket, Kamala — Swanky stay! Super friendly staff, dreamy pools and a spa. Room tip: Ask about humidity control when checking in. Getting Around: Rent a scooter for max freedom, or use local taxis/Grab for short hops. Longtail boats are the move for island trips — bargain a little before you set sail! Food & Tip-Offs: Eat beachfront whenever possible! Simple tip: Bring swim gear (every spot is a swim opportunity). Sunscreen is a must. Cash is still king for smaller vendors. Phuket’s weather is warm year-round, but expect epic sunsets especially in Nov–Apr.
